Hi, I do the following: hythread_suspend_disable(); <do unsafe actions> hysem_wait(semaphore); <do unsafe actions> hythread_suspend_enable(); By saying hythread_suspend_disable(); I expect the thread can't be suspended until hythread_suspend_enable() is called. But hysem_wait() resets disabled mode and enables thread suspension. As a result GC can happen when it must not. hysem_wait is based on conditional variables so the same can happen when conditional variables is used. Do you see the problem here? Or I miss something?
